CONTOOCOOK, NH: Marjorie Carnes Peasley, of Contoocook, NH, passed away Saturday afternoon February 22, 2020, at Pleasant View Center in Concord, NH, after a long period of declining health.
Born June 19, 1927, in Concord, NH, she was the only child of the late Herbert and Irene Carnes of Contoocook, NH. She attended school in Hopkinton, NH. and graduated from Hopkinton High School.
She was a longtime member of the Riverside Rebekahs and was a member of St. Andrews Episcopal Church of Hopkinton since childhood. Marjorie enjoyed tending her plants and had quite a “green thumb.” She also enjoyed crocheting, crossword puzzles, picture puzzles, was an excellent cook and enjoyed having her family around her.
Marjorie was predeceased by Raymond A. Peasley, her loving husband of more than sixty (60) years,her son, Gary R. Peasley on September 17, 1987, and her grandparents, Abraham and Addie Bell of Port Chester, NY. She is survived by her son, Wayne and his wife Donna Peasley of Henniker, NH, and several nieces and nephews.
